Cubital tunnel syndrome can cause numbness, tingling, and weakness in the hand, especially affecting the ring and pinky fingers. This condition occurs when the ulnar nerve becomes compressed at the elbow, leading to irritation that can worsen with bending, leaning, or repetitive use.

Cubital tunnel syndrome is a condition involving compression of the ulnar nerve at the elbow. This nerve runs behind the inside of the elbow, commonly known as the “funny bone nerve,” and travels down into the hand.
When the ulnar nerve compression elbow increases, it can lead to symptoms in the forearm, hand, and fingers. This condition is often referred to as ulnar nerve entrapment and can worsen if left untreated.

| Condition | Area Affected |
|---|---|
| Cubital tunnel syndrome | Ring and pinky fingers |
| Carpal tunnel syndrome | Thumb, index, and middle fingers |
Understanding this difference helps guide proper treatment.
